Warning Signs You Need AC Unit Water Removal
Don’t ignore the warning signs of AC unit water removal, they can lead to costly repairs and even health hazards. Keep an eye out for these red flags: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
If you notice a persistent musty smell coming from your AC unit or surrounding areas, it’s likely a sign of water damage or mold growth. Don’t delay, call us today to schedule an inspection.
Water Stains or Discoloration
Look for water stains or discoloration on your walls, ceiling, or floors near your AC unit. This can show a leak or water damage that needs prompt attention.
Unusual Noises or Leaks
Listen for unusual noises or signs of leaks coming from your AC unit, such as dripping water or hissing sounds. These can be indicative of a problem that needs professional attention.
Increased Energy Bills
Notice a spike in your energy bills without any changes to your usage or environment. This can be a sign of a malfunctioning AC unit or inefficient system.
Visible Water Damage
Check for visible signs of water damage around your AC unit, such as warping, buckling, or swelling of surrounding materials.
Unpleasant Odors or Fumes
Be aware of unpleasant odors or fumes coming from your AC unit or surrounding areas, which can show mold growth or other health hazards.

AC Unit Water Removal Cost in Warner Robins, GA
The cost of AC unit water removal in Warner Robins, GA, can vary depending on the severity of the damage, size of the affected area, and local conditions. Here are some estimated price ranges for common scenarios: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Minor water damage repair |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, materials needed for repair |
| Major water damage restoration | $2,500 – $10,000 | Severity of damage, size of affected area, equipment needed for drying and sanitizing |
| AC unit replacement | $5,000 – $20,000 | Age and condition of existing AC unit, type and quality of replacement unit |
| Mold remediation |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, type and severity of mold growth |
| Dehumidification and drying services |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area, equipment needed for drying and dehumidification |
| Sanitizing and disinfecting services | $200 – $1,000 | Size of affected area, type and severity of contamination |
Keep in mind that these are estimated price ranges, and the actual cost of AC unit water removal in Warner Robins, GA, will depend on the specifics of your situation. We offer free estimates to ensure you know exactly what to expect.
